What is startpm.exe?

startpm.exe is part of Nethost according to the startpm.exe version information.

startpm.exe's description is "Nethost"

startpm.exe is usually located in the 'c:\users\%USERNAME%\appdata\local\temp\' folder.

Some of the anti-virus scanners at VirusTotal detected startpm.exe.

Digital signatures [?]

startpm.exe is not signed.

VirusTotal report

24 of the 57 anti-virus programs at VirusTotal detected the startpm.exe file. That's a 42% detection rate.
